This is a glass door cabinet that sits on top of a secretary desk the my parents bought about 55 years ago. I honored such a treasured piece by placing tea cups passed from generations. My great grandmother started the collection, and they are all bone china. My mother inherited them and added more. Then I inherited them and added more. I cannot tell you my favorite piece because each one has a beauty of their own. I have a set of silver f mini salt & pepper shakers on the top shelf, a tinker bell from Disneyland, a Kokopely from Arizona, the bottom shelf has that lovely teapot that winds up underneath to play music while drinking tea and matching plate for crumpets, and the lover right corner is a glass tiger from a trip to China
